AVI Foodsystems, Inc is Hiring a Cook 2nd shift Near Wilmington, OH

AVI Foodsystems is looking for an energetic and optimistic team member to fill the role of Cook, Full-time, 2nd Shift.

Founded in 1960, AVI Foodsystems has evolved into one of the most respected and trusted food service companies in the nation.

Providing comprehensive food services with a focus on the highest quality and freshest ingredients, impeccable service and total value is the reputation we have earned and live up to everyday.

Duties & Responsibilities :

  • Please customers by providing a pleasant dining experience
  • Assemble, combine, and cook ingredients
  • Maintain a sanitary kitchen
  • Attend to the detail and presentation of each order
  • Place and expedite orders
  • Prepare ingredients by following recipes; slicing, cutting, chopping, mincing, stirring, whipping, and mixing ingredients
  • Complete hot meal preparation by grilling, sautéing, roasting, frying, and broiling ingredients and assembling and refrigerating cold ingredients
  • Adhere to proper food handling, sanitation, and safety procedures
  • Maintain appropriate dating, labeling, and rotation of all food items
  • Stores leftovers according to established standards
  • Contribute to daily, holiday, and theme menus in collaboration with the team

Requirements :

  • 2 or more years of cooking experience to include food preparation
  • Strong working knowledge of food preparation techniques, cooking methods, and safety and sanitation practices
  • Exceptional food presentation skills
  • Familiarity with general kitchen equipment and appliances
  • Strong work ethic and high energy level

Benefits :

AVI is proud of its team members and appreciates the hard work, loyalty and committed service they provide every day, which is why we offer the following :

  • Competitive compensation
  • Health, dental, vision, and life insurance for full-time team members
  • 401(k) with generous company match
  • Paid vacations and holidays
  • Immense training and growth opportunities
